I noticed two minor (?) issues with mouse selection:

(1) I can't select the full text of one line up to and including the newline. Whenever I drag the mouse to the beginning of a line the first character of that line gets included in the selection. This is different than e.g. the behavior in Fl_Text_Display/_Editor.
(2) The text(false) method outputs one additional line at the end. Since I fixed buffer trimming (commit aa02a0297be) this is "only" an additional LF character but it's still not correct. I looked into it but maybe you can find the culprit and fix it easier than me.
